Exegesis

The verse opens with velo {וְלֹא | wə-lōʾ} ‘and not’, marking a prohibitive command.

In contextDeuteronomy 19:21

And your eye shall not have pity ; life for life, eye for eye, tooth for tooth, hand for hand, foot for foot.
